Output 3aa98264aa9c32456b12a94d8c0642a81a9f4ab6ee03369e01e16a43c21b672b:24

value
3127708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 068e5caf28b9bb1efa6c2a82c054ea378e820a68 OP_EQUAL
address
32HgXBacHHyUmWC5b3s8XaTxLkMmeHFExc
transaction
3aa98264aa9c32456b12a94d8c0642a81a9f4ab6ee03369e01e16a43c21b672b
spent
true